Ukraine on Thursday mentioned Vladimir Putin had launched a “full-scale invasion”, after the Russian president introduced a “particular army operation” within the east of the nation.
Shortly after his televised tackle, explosions were reported within the outskirts of the cities of Kharkiv, Kramatorsk, Mariupol, in addition to the capital Kiev.
US president Joe Biden and Boris Johnson joined different international powers in condemning Russia’s ‘unprovoked and unjustified’ assault on Ukraine as and promised to carry it “accountable”.
Contained in the nation, airports have been shut down briefly and secured towards potential Russian plane landings, whereas Russia has closed its personal airspace across the border to civilian entry for the following 4 months.
Ukrainian president Volodymyr Zelensky mentioned the federal government is introducing martial regulation on all territories of the state and urged residents to remain at residence as a lot as attainable.

Kiev streets refill with individuals fleeing
President Zelensky mentioned in his assertion a short time in the past that missile strikes had taken place on his nation’s infrastructure in addition to Ukrainian forces, and launched partial martial regulation, write Kim Sengupta from Kiev.
He urged individuals to remain at residence, however the roads out of Kiev started to be filled with automobiles quickly after the air strikes started.
Each of Kiev’s airports, Borispil and Zhulyana, in addition to a army airfield within the outskirts of the capital have been hit by the missiles and drone strikes, in response to Ukrainian officers; explosions nearer to town centre counsel that plenty of authorities buildings may have been within the line of fireplace. Anti-aircraft fireplace was heard in all of the places.
In the meantime, there are reviews within the Ukrainian media that Russian marine infantry have landed within the Odessa and Mariupol within the Black Sea area and had been trying to take over each cities. An assault there, in addition to in jap Ukraine, would additional isolate Kiev.

Putin declares battle to ‘de-Nazify’ Ukraine
Reporting from Kiev the place he says explosions could be heard, our World Affairs Editor Kim Sengupta summarises the morning’s occasions:
Vladimir Putin ordered the invasion of Ukraine within the early hours of Thursday morning after massing troops on the nation’s borders for weeks, and warned the West to not intervene within the unfolding battle.
Explosions had been heard within the outskirts of the cities of Kharkiv, Kramatorsk, Mariupol, in addition to the capital Kiev, quickly after the Russian president introduced the beginning of the battle in a televised speech.
Mr Putin spoke of the launch of a “particular army operation” within the east of the nation the place he had recognised the separatist “Peoples’ Republics” of Donetsk and Luhansk “to defend individuals who have been victims of abuse and genocide from the Kiev regime”.
The Russian president mentioned he didn’t wish to occupy Ukraine, however he supposed to “de-Nazify” the state and demanded that the nation’s armed forces lay down their weapons, saying that in any other case, Kiev will probably be chargeable for “attainable bloodshed”.
One attainable Russian plan of motion, in response to plenty of worldwide diplomatic and defence sources, is to chop off the Ukrainian forces within the east of the nation and threaten Kiev, demanding regime change – the resignation of President Volodymyr Zelensky.
Hours earlier than the army motion started, the Ukrainian authorities introduced in a collection of emergency measures and requested Turkey to shut the Black Sea straits to forestall Russia from launching naval assaults.
After a day of claiming that they had been below intense Ukrainian assault, the “Peoples Republics” requested for army help from Moscow. Russian tv channels, in the meantime, confirmed what they mentioned had been lists of individuals, Ukrainians and probably foreigners, who had been chargeable for “battle crimes” and can be dropped at justice.
Earlier than the assaults started, President Zelensky appeared on tv saying that he needed peace and urged the Russian individuals to not imagine the narrative for battle. He mentioned: “You might be being informed that we hate Russian tradition. How may we hate a tradition, any tradition?
“Ukraine in your information and Ukraine in actuality — that’s two completely different nations,Lots of you could have been to Ukraine, a lot of you could have family in Ukraine… Take heed to us, hear us. The individuals of Ukraine need peace.”
In keeping with reviews, Mr Zelensky had tried to contact Mr Putin a number of instances in the midst of the night, however the Russian President refused to take his name.
US President Joe Biden condemned what he known as an “unprovoked and unjustified assault by Russian army forces”. He says “the prayers of all the world are with the individuals of Ukraine. President Putin has chosen a premeditated battle that can carry a catastrophic lack of life and human struggling”.
“Russia alone is chargeable for the loss of life and destruction this assault will carry, and the US and its allies and companions will reply in a united and decisive approach. The world will maintain Russia accountable.”
